Region E<br />

Region E (right channel, 48-57") resembles aspects of the previous two regions;<br />

transforming and resynthesizing familiar characteristics of the Regions C and D. The<br />

Region’s form (a pair of introductory events followed by a contrasting continuation) and<br />

use of a wide register (with elements from c. 50-7000 Hz.) resembles that of D, while<br />

individual gestures recall events from Region C. Specifically, Region E’s first two events<br />

recall the opening of Region C with diffuse glissandi, although this time they are<br />

ascending, rather than descending. The exceptionally wide glissing noise band of Event 1<br />

(48.2") is echoed by a less diffuse gliss in Event 2 (49.8"). There are fewer glissandi in the<br />

continuation of Region E (Events 3a and 3b), and in this regard, too, it resembles Region<br />

C, which began with an oblique gesture before settling on a more level continuation.<br />
